ICING · Improving Cement-based Infrastructure from Nanoscale Grounds

HORIZONStatus: SIGNED1 April 202631 March 2028EU funding €242,261Call HORIZON-MSCA-2024-PF-01

This project addresses the pressing need for sustainable and durable concrete infrastructure by investigating the degradation mechanisms of cement paste (the binder phase of concrete) materials at the atomic level. Leveraging advanced atomistic simulations, we will focus on the chemo-poro-mechanical properties of cement paste to provide a fundamental understanding of how environmental factors and material composition influence material degradation processes including freeze-thaw, carbonation, alkali-silica reaction, and accelerated decalcification in saline solution, based on which effective mitigation strategies such as compositional optimisation, molecular structure design, and surface modification will be developed to enhance the long-term durability of cementitious infrastructure, contributing to a reduction in the carbon footprint of the construction industry. The project will employ a multidisciplinary approach combining computational modelling, experimental validation, and material development.
